The following firearms were used in the film Dogma:

Dogma (1999)











Desert Eagle Mark I

Seen in Gunstore display case and later used by Loki.

Matte stainless Desert Eagle MK I - .357 Magnum.
Loki holds a Desert Eagle on the only 'good' board member for not saying 'God bless you' when he sneezed

Glock 17

Seen in Gunstore display case.

A Generation 3 Glock 17 9x19mm. Note the finger grooves, thumb reliefs, and accessory rail on the frame, which differentiate it from the older model.

Beretta 92FS

Seen in Gunstore display case.

Beretta 92FS - 9x19mm.

Ingram MAC-11

Used by Azrael, picked up by Rufus, and then used by Jay.

RPB Industries MAC-11, .380 ACP

M1 Garand

Seen in gun rack at gun store.

M1 Garand semiautomatic Rifle with leather M1917 sling - .30-06
